Ohio Wesleyan and Case Western Reserve University offer an early admission pathway for OWU students seeking to earn master's degrees in any of the four programs at CWRU's acclaimed Weatherhead School of Management.
Through the collaboration, Ohio Wesleyan students accepted into one of the Weatherhead School pathway programs will receive a scholarship of at least $10,000, with the potential to receive additional merit aid.

Case Western Reserve is part of the CFA Institute University Recognition Program, with the Weatherhead School's Master of Finance program recognized for incorporating at least 70 percent of the CFA Program Candidate Body of Knowledge (CBOK) and for emphasizing the CFA Institute Code of Ethics and Standards of Practice. Graduates are well-positioned to obtain the Chartered Financial Analyst® designation, widely regarded as the most respected investment credential in the world. Ohio Wesleyan's Finance program also is part of the CFA Institute University Recognition program.
Applications for all four master's degree programs are being accepted now, with application fees waived for OWU students. Applicants will be notified of an early admission decision at the end of their junior year.
To be eligible, Ohio Wesleyan students must achieve an OWU grade point average of 3.0 or higher by the end of their junior year, earn a 3.0 or higher in specifically required prerequisite courses, and, ultimately, graduate from Ohio Wesleyan with a GPA of 3.0 or higher.
The Weatherhead School is test-optional, with applicants able to waive the Graduate Management Admission Test (GMAT) and Graduate Record Examinations (GRE) test if they choose to do so.
Ohio Wesleyan's partnership with Case Western Reserve provides no guarantee of admission. Students must meet the Weatherhead School master's program entry requirements.
